Originally Posted by SockPuppet
79S, are those 1:7 twist?


Yes they are. I shoot 80.5 Berger’s out of them, loaded long so single shot. I want to get some 85 nosler rdf they claim (nosler) you can shoot them from mag length. Berger claimed the same thing with the 80.5 full bore but I didn’t have much luck. But those 77 Sierra’s tmk’s at mag length shoot great.

Just a DPMS bbl (chrome lined) on a Stag upper w Anderson lower.
JP spring kit and set screw to get trigger decent.
Reg cheap furniture (like smaller OD handguard) and a Magpul grip.
Kinda heavy, but comfy. Shot recovery is good.

Does around .75" for 5 at 100 benched (when I slapped a 2-7X on it).

Had a Bushmaster during the ban, same 11.5/5.5 bbl but w fixed carry handle. Had a junk 4X on top, stock trigger and it did 1".
Slapped together a non chrome lined 1 in 9 full 16" on Stag upper/lower and it did .75" (2-7X and trigger job).

I find 1 in 9 usable and accurate, good enough for chucks or yotes out to 200. Which is what a non bipod rig would be used for.

Buds have heavy bbl $$$ ARs and go PD blasting. They are not walking rifles.
